Today we are happy to introduce dark mode for LogSpace. It's like putting on a pair of sunglasses.

On the login page and in your settings you will find a button that will allow you to change the theme. Light mode is still available for those that prefer it. Also an automatic setting has been added that will use your platform's setting if supported by your browser. Otherwise you'll get dark mode.

Using dark mode has various use cases. According to the Material Design website, dark themes can "help improve visual ergonomics by reducing eye strain" among other benefits. Also, since the palette contains less blue light on average, it should be less likely to interfere with sleep. This is a topic that Paul recently discussed in his blog regarding sleeping schedules.
